Dell Technologies recently reported its fastest sales growth since its return to the public market in 2018, propelling shares up 39%. The company has shifted from being a “sleepy legacy tech” firm to a high-growth AI story, according to market observers. Dell’s server business now focuses on assembling systems that incorporate high-performance graphics processing units (GPUs), which are critical for artificial intelligence workloads. This pivot has allowed the company to capitalize on surging demand for AI computing infrastructure from enterprises and cloud providers. The sales growth reported marks a stark turnaround from Dell’s previous years of modest expansion, as AI-related orders have become a major revenue driver. The company did not provide specific forward guidance, but the earnings release highlighted the strength of its server and networking segment.

Key takeaways from Dell’s latest performance include the company’s successful repositioning within the AI supply chain. By focusing on GPU-packed server assembly, Dell has moved beyond its traditional PC and storage businesses into a higher-growth area that could have broad implications for the IT hardware sector. The 39% share price surge suggests strong market enthusiasm for AI-related hardware plays, potentially influencing valuations across similar legacy firms. The sales growth pace—the fastest since Dell’s 2018 public re-listing—may signal a structural shift in enterprise spending toward AI infrastructure. Competitors in the server and networking space might also see increased investor attention as demand for AI-capable hardware continues to rise.

From an investment perspective, Dell’s AI pivot presents both opportunities and risks. The company’s ability to sustain elevated sales growth could depend on ongoing enterprise adoption of AI tools and the availability of advanced GPUs from suppliers. Potential headwinds include supply chain constraints, rising competition from other server assemblers, and the cyclical nature of large-scale data center investments. Investors may want to monitor Dell’s margin trends as it scales its AI server business, alongside broader semiconductor demand trends. The sharp share move also highlights the volatile nature of AI-themed stocks; cautious positioning might be warranted given the premium already reflected in the price.
